#0d0a26 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d0a26 is composed of 5.1% red, 3.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 9.4%. #0d0a26 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a144c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#0d0a26 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0d0a26 has RGB values of R:13, G:10,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 854566.

Shades and Tints of #0d0a26

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020207 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d0a26

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#171719 is the less saturated color, while #06012f is the most saturated one.
